North Wales Police have moved swiftly to arrest a man wanted on suspicion of murder in Wrexham.

Police have announced this morning that Jordan Davidson, who was wanted on suspicion of murder in Wrexham, was arrested overnight.

Police issued an appeal to locate Jordan Davidson yesterday afternoon, after a suspicious death in Wrexham.

Armed police attended an address in Rhosddu late Monday night, with further armed operations reported in the area through Tuesday.

Armed units were circulating in the town centre late yesterday afternoon – and just after 6pm yesterday evening armed units were seen congregating near to the ASDA supermarket before attending an address on Queensway.

Police were seen to detain individuals last night with weapons drawn, one of which is pictured above.

In yesterday’s appeal police warned the public about Mr Davidson, saying: “Under no circumstances should anyone approach him as he may be in possession of weapons’, explaining the firm well equipped method of detaining people last night.
